    Yeah the rebuild kit must have been for one of those 5 cylinder Audis. I didn't even think to check. At least it didn't take me too long to figure it out. The sensor module is the same though, so I achieved what I set out to do!

    On another note bleeding a completely dry dry brake system is hard to do! It took me a while this morning to get enough fluid in the system to be able to get the pedal up.

    In the end I used the compressor set down to 20psi and pressure bled it to get the fluid through the lines. Then I finished it off the usual way.

    Ok. It's track time. James (Water Boy) has filled me in on the details. Thanks James!

    I'll be filling in the entry form and posting off a cheque tonight for the Phillip Island Circuit Familiarisation to be held on Saturday April 26th 2008.

    The regs can be found here. http://www.piarc.com.au/

    There's a bit of time to go yet so I'll have time to sort out the last few little issues to make the car trackworthy.

    • Bolt in Fire Extinguisher
    • Fix fuel pump cutoff circuit
    • Restore factory crankcase breather (or install catch can).
    • Bonnet restraint
    There's also a few non mandatory things I'd like to get done.
    • Bolt in the Race Seat.
    • Bolt up the Harness
    • Bed in the new brakes
    • Wear in the new track tyres.
    I'll pull the back seat out and generally clean out the cabin and tie every thing down. There's other stuff that should be done like battery and tow point stickers etc, but I don't think that they're required for this sort of event.

    I'm going to try and make good use of the instruction available on the day. There's a lot to learn.

    Took the car out for a spot of dinner. Looks like the front LH CV might be shot. I'm getting a growling / grinding noise from that side.

    Noise is related to road speed, braking does not change noise.

    The wheel bearing on that side was shot, I guess I might have damaged the CV at the same time.

    I'll pull the CV apart after the Jamboree on Sunday and check it out.

    Apart from that the car feels great on the road , the steering is tight and responsive and the brakes feel really good.

    I haven't pushed the car hard yet. I want to bed in the brakes properly and didn't want to blow that CV on the way home.

    I've had so much of it apart I'm wary of going too far or too fast for the first few outings.
